My customized folders (picture in thumbnail view) disappears when I copy folder to a different drive (or even different location on same drive).
Anybody knows how to retain the customized settings or force XP to display manually added thumbnail? I want to be able to ad a picture as a folder’s thumbnail ONCE and have it there forever when I copy and move the folder. It seems to me that this is the idea of customization folders. Why doesn’t it work?

So your saying the actual file doesn't copy or it just doesn't show the picture in the folder?
Did you change the view setting to thumbnails in the new folder? Those settings don't transfer from one folder to another.

I just checked some music folders and the folder.jpg file transfered. I did have to change the view to thumbnails for the picture to show up though.

Windows stores the thumbnails in a hidden file "Thumbs.db" , Which it stores in the folder your pics are

When you copy your folder to another drive, it only copies the visible files.


So tools - folder options - view(tab) - and show hidden file and untick Hide protected operating files

You will now see the thumbs.db file in you pics folder (assuming you have allowed to cache thumbnails (also on the view tab))


Now copy the folder to another drive (it will copy over thumbs.db), it should keep you previous settings


I would go back into folder options and restore defaults when your done
